Earn More Money And Spend Less At School
You do not have to spend tens of thousands of dollars on college to get a high-paying job. Plumbing is a great way for people who want to make a lot of money without having to spend a lot of money early on in school.
Those who want to install pipes can go to vocational school or community college at a much lower cost than those who prefer four-year degrees. At Central Plumbing, you can even get job training, where you will learn how to trade with a skilled carpenter while being paid. Getting paid while studying is a wonderful and rare opportunity.
Once you have achieved the level of independent operation, you can run your truck and set your own schedule. According to PayScale, plumbers in 2020 make between $ 30,721 – $ 79,791 a year, while main plumbers earn between $ 42,604 – $ 100,685.
